In today's rapidly evolving digital landscape, businesses are increasingly turning to AI technologies to enhance their branding and marketing strategies. However, the COVID-19 pandemic has resulted in a surge in unemployment rates globally, challenging companies to rethink their approach to engaging with consumers in a sensitive and impactful way. As businesses navigate these uncertain times, leveraging AI in branding and marketing can offer unique solutions to connect with customers while also being mindful of the prevailing sentiment of job insecurity and financial instability. Here are some ways in which AI can be harnessed to enhance branding and marketing efforts during times of unemployment: 1. Personalized Customer Experiences: AI-powered algorithms can analyze vast amounts of data to create personalized customer experiences. By understanding consumer behavior and preferences, businesses can tailor their branding and marketing strategies to resonate with their target audience on a deeper level, thereby fostering loyalty and trust. 2. Sentiment Analysis: AI tools can analyze social media, online reviews, and other digital platforms to gauge the prevailing sentiment around unemployment. By listening to the concerns and needs of consumers, businesses can adapt their messaging and communication to address these sentiments effectively, demonstrating empathy and understanding. 3. Targeted Advertising: AI algorithms can optimize advertising campaigns to target specific demographics most likely to respond positively to the brand's message. By focusing marketing efforts on relevant audiences, businesses can maximize their impact and reach, even amidst economic uncertainty. 4. Enhanced Customer Service: Chatbots and virtual assistants powered by AI can provide immediate assistance to customers, addressing their queries and concerns in real-time. By streamlining customer service processes, businesses can improve overall satisfaction levels and build stronger relationships with consumers. 5. Brand Monitoring: AI tools can monitor online conversations and brand mentions to identify any shifts in consumer perception and sentiment. By staying informed about how the brand is being perceived, businesses can proactively address any concerns or issues that may arise, safeguarding their brand reputation.
